Ron Paul Stirs Up Presidential Debate

According to an online poll posted by MSNBC, Rep. Ron Paul (R-Texas) handily won the first debate among Republican presidential candidates.

Paul garnered higher positive ratings and lower negative numbers than any of the other nine candidates on the stage. And in an ABC post-debate Internet survey, the congressman took more than 85 percent of the votes cast.

Online polls are not scientific, and a single person may vote in one poll multiple times; doing well in such a poll is therefore not necessarily reflective of how well a campaign is actually doing. But Internet buzz is often a sign of passionate or active supporters.

Paul has a strong online presence, and his supporters admire his commitment to abolishing the IRS, his steadfast opposition to a national ID card, and his forthright tone.
